During the 2020-2021 academic year, Otterbein University handed out 9 bachelor's degrees in health communication. This is an increase of 29% over the previous year when 7 degrees were handed out.

Otterbein Health Communication Bachelor’s Program

Of the 9 health communication students who graduated with a bachelor's degree in 2020-2021 from Otterbein, about 22% were men and 78% were women.
